À propos de Source thermale « Muli Muwai »
Mulimuwai Hot Spring is a modern spa and bathhouse in Xining, designed as a one-stop leisure venue offering hot-spring soaking, saunas, massages, family leisure pools, and food service under one roof. As a year-round indoor facility, it offers a relaxing contrast to the high-altitude outdoor sightseeing that makes up most of a Xining-area itinerary, and is particularly popular with local families and with travelers looking to unwind after long days on the plateau.
The facility follows the standard layout of large Chinese urban hot-spring centers. The core is a series of pools of varying temperatures — typically ranging from warm to very hot — fed by geothermally heated mineral water, with separate male and female bathing zones for nude soaking and a shared family leisure area for clothed use. Around the pools are saunas, steam rooms, relaxation lounges, treatment rooms for massage and body scrubs, and food and drink counters. Some areas are themed — mineral-infused pools, herbal pools, salt saunas — and the overall design is closer to a modern Korean-style jjimjilbang or Japanese onsen resort than to a rustic outdoor hot spring.
For most independent foreign travelers, Mulimuwai is best treated as an evening or rest-day option rather than as a primary attraction. After a long day at Kumbum Monastery, Qinghai Lake, or any of the high-altitude sites around Xining, two or three hours of soaking in mineral water is genuinely restorative, and the leisurely pace of the experience makes a pleasant change from crowded sightseeing spots. The facility is also a useful option on rainy or cold days, when the plateau weather can be unforgiving.
Practicalities matter. Chinese hot-spring centers have specific etiquette around nude bathing, gender-segregated areas, and shared family zones, and signage is typically in Chinese only. Foreign visitors should bring swimwear for the shared areas, basic toiletries, and slip-on shoes; towels, robes, and lockers are normally provided. Mandarin is the working language.
Mulimuwai is not a destination to fly across China for, but as a rest stop on a longer Qinghai-Tibet itinerary, or as a quiet evening activity in Xining itself, it does what it sets out to do — and does it comfortably.
